Steve James

Steve James, guitarist, songwriter and luthier passed away January 6, 2023. 

He died at home from a glioblastoma brain tumor. His illness was brief but devastatingly fast and he was unable to say goodbye properly to many of his valued and beloved friends, artistic colleagues and students. 

R.I.P. Steve James July 15, 1950-January 6, 2023
